The median household income in Grand Mound, IA is $84,286, which is 15.1% above the national average of $73,224. Per capita income is $31,076. The poverty rate of 12.1% is higher than the IA state average of 10.7%. The Gini index of income inequality is 0.3248, where 0 represents perfect equality and 1 represents maximum inequality. The unemployment rate is 4.2%, compared to the state average of 3.6%. 12.3%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
